Animal Equality revisits a UK pig farm that supplies Tesco
Animal Equality investigated a Red Tractor-certified farm in Southwest England. At Cross Farm, they found dead piglets, filthy conditions, and extreme confinement. Despite being exposed in 2017, Cross Farm continues to supply Tesco, a major UK grocery store. Animal Equality filed a formal complaint about its alleged crimes.

Rabbits crying out in fear inside Mexican slaughterhouse
Animal Equality's investigation into Mexico's rabbit meat industry exposed overcrowded cages, slaughter without stunning, and rabbits crying out before slaughter. Conducted at farms in Querétaro and Mexico City, the footage showed rabbits fully conscious as their throats were slit, violating Mexican law. Complaints were filed with authorities, but no response has been received.

Four-month investigation into German pig farm
Animal Equality’s undercover investigation in Germany revealed severe and intentional cruelty at one of the country's largest pig farms. Over four months, the investigation documented widespread abuse and neglect, with workers deliberately mistreating piglets and allegedly violating European Union laws. These findings, broadcast on Germany’s leading television news channel, resulted in criminal charges against the farm and its employees.

Horses slaughtered in front of each other in Spain slaughterhouse
For the first time in over a decade, Animal Equality’s team in Spain unveiled an investigation into the horse meat industry. At a slaughterhouse in Asturias, investigators documented horses being inadequately stunned, causing the animals to be slaughtered while conscious. The investigation also revealed that horses witnessed each other being slaughtered.

Mother pigs confined, piglets mutilated on Spanish pig farm
Despite many in Spain advocating for a ban on cages, Animal Equality’s investigative footage shows the ongoing and extreme confinement of mother pigs. The footage also exposed the mutilation of piglets without anesthesia, including the cutting of their tails. These tails were found scattered on the floor and left in buckets. Meanwhile, the rotting bodies of dead piglets littered the farm.

Disease, mutilation and cannibalism on Spanish pig farms
During an investigation inside five pig farms, Animal Equality in Spain found pigs with inflamed, pus-filled wounds, prolapsed uteruses and rectums, swollen genitals, lameness, mutilations, dead rats and maggots, and pigs nibbling on the carcasses of other pigs. This investigation release focused on the fattening stage, which takes place after weaning.

Behind the carton of eggs: Brazil hen investigation
Animal Equality in Brazil conducted an investigation into hens factory farms, including four farms and a specialized hen slaughterhouse. Over 95% of hens in Brazil are kept in caged systems, where each bird has less space than a sheet of paper. With 13 birds per cage, investigators have documented cannibalism, extreme heat stress, various injuries, and disease.

Drone footage shows life & death of fish on UK slaughter boats
In late 2022, Animal Equality conducted a two-month drone investigation into Scotland’s salmon and trout industry, exposing the harsh realities of fish farming. Footage reveals overcrowded pens, fish violently thrown and arriving at slaughter—bruised and bloody—left to suffocate, and even killed while still conscious.

Investigation into a “quality” pig farm in Northern Italy
Animal Equality has released footage from a large pig farm in Lombardy, Italy—part of a series of investigations since 2019 exposing animal suffering at facilities marketing products as “Made-in-Italy excellence.” The investigation shows pigs with untreated sores and wounds, dying animals left in their own waste, piglets’ bodies torn apart, and buckets of rotting remains. Animal Equality is urging authorities to take immediate legal action against the farm.
